Which one of the following molecules is paramagnetic?
A
F2
B
B2
C
Li2
D
N2
Answer
B2
Explanation
Solution
Molecules in which unpaired electrons are present, are paramagnetic while that have absence of unpaired electrons, are diamagnetic.
F2(18)=σ1s2,σ∗1s2,σ2s2σ∗2s2,σ2pz2,
π2px2≈π2py2,π∗2px2≈π∗2py2
(No unpaired electron, so diamagnetic)
B2(10)=σ1s2,σ∗1s2σ2s2,σ∗2s2,π2px1≈π2py1
(Two unpaired electrons, paramagnetic)
Li2(6)=σ1s2,σ∗1s2,σ2s2
(No unpaired electrons, diamagnetic)
N2(14)=σ1s2,σ∗1s2,σ2s2,σ∗2s2,π2px2
≈π2py2,σ2pz2
(No unpaired electrons, diamagnetic)
